With CUET 2026 approaching rapidly and only a few weeks remaining, many students find themselves at a critical juncture—unsure of what to prioritize, how to revise effectively, and how to convert preparation into performance.
Addressing this exact challenge, EaseToLearn, an AI-driven exam readiness platform, has introduced a 5-Week CUET Acceleration Program, designed specifically for students entering the final phase of their preparation.
Unlike conventional learning approaches that focus on content consumption, the program emphasizes diagnosis, targeted improvement, and performance conditioning, enabling students to make the most of the limited time available.

A Shift from “Studying More” to “Preparing Smarter”
The final weeks before CUET often become overwhelming for students due to the vast syllabus and lack of clarity on high-impact topics.
The EaseToLearn 5-Week Program is structured around a simple but powerful idea:
“In the last phase, clarity matters more than coverage.”
The program helps students:
• Identify high-priority topics based on previous CUET trends
• Detect weak areas at a concept level
• Practice different CUET question formats
• Improve speed and accuracy under timed conditions
• Develop a smart attempt strategy to avoid negative marking losses

Key Features of the Program
The program integrates EaseToLearn’s core technology features to create a structured preparation environment:
Gap Fixer (AI Diagnostic Engine)
Pinpoints exactly where students are losing marks—down to the topic and concept level—so preparation becomes focused rather than scattered.
Tony – AI Learning Buddy
Provides instant doubt resolution and concept clarity, ensuring that students do not remain stuck during revision.
Pace-X (Performance Conditioning)
Trains students to handle CUET’s time pressure by improving speed, accuracy, and decision-making in real-time.
Exam Room (Mock Environment)
Simulates real exam conditions with full-length mocks and detailed analytics, helping students track readiness objectively.
